Halo by Scam AI vs Pylar: Detailed Comparison

Overview

In the rapidly evolving landscape of AI security, two distinct products address different facets of the same overarching concern: protecting organizations from AI-driven threats. Halo by Scam AI focuses on real-time deepfake detection during live video calls, while Pylar provides a secure data access layer for AI agents. This comparison explores their features, pricing, and ideal use cases to help you decide which aligns with your needs.

Feature Comparison

FeatureHalo by Scam AIPylar
Primary Use CaseReal-time deepfake detection on live video callsSecure data access for AI agents via SQL views and MCP tools
DeploymentOn-device Windows appCloud-based platform with web editor
SecurityOn-device processing, no data leaves deviceView-level governance, credential isolation, zero raw DB access
IntegrationsZoom, Teams, Meet, WebEx, SlackData sources (Postgres, Snowflake) and agent builders (Claude, Cursor, n8n, etc.)
Real-timeScans video frames ~4x/sec, flags synthetic facesReal-time observability, but not media analysis
UISystem tray app with alertsWeb editor with SQL, MCP generation, dashboard
ComplianceGDPR-friendly, no storageAudit trails, but cloud-based

Pros and Cons

Halo by Scam AI

Pros:

  • Real-time deepfake detection on live calls
  • On-device processing ensures privacy and low latency
  • Works across multiple conferencing platforms
  • No cloud dependency, reducing attack surface
  • Audit trail for compliance

Cons:

  • Windows-only (no macOS or mobile support mentioned)
  • Limited to video call security, not broader data protection
  • Requires installation on each device

Pylar

Pros:

  • Centralized control over agent data access
  • Supports multiple data sources and joins
  • Automatic MCP tool generation from SQL views
  • Publish once, connect to many agent builders
  • Full observability with evals and error tracking

Cons:

  • Cloud-based, so data passes through third-party servers (though secured)
  • Requires setup of views and tools, may have learning curve
  • Not designed for real-time media analysis

Verdict

Choose Halo if your primary concern is protecting against deepfake video call fraud in real-time, especially for finance or executive communications. Choose Pylar if you need to securely connect AI agents to your data stack with governance and observability. They solve different problems and can be complementary in an enterprise security stack.
